啟用mysql的sql日誌

2022-04-22 12:09:24 字數 469 閱讀 4547

在mysql命令列或者客戶端管理工具中執行:show variables like "general_log%";

結果:general_log off

general_log_file /var/lib/mysql/localhost.log

off說明沒有開啟日誌記錄

分別執行開啟日誌以及日誌路徑和日誌檔名

set global general_log_file = '/var/lib/mysql/localhost.log';

set global general_log = 'on';

還要注意

這時執行的所有sql都會別記錄下來,方便檢視,但是如果重啟mysql就會停止記錄需要重新設定

show variables like "log_output%";

如果是none,需要設定

set global log_output='table,file'

MYSQL啟用日誌,和檢視日誌

mysql有以下幾種日誌 錯誤日誌 log err 查詢日誌 log 慢查詢日誌 log slow queries 更新日誌 log update 二進位制日誌 log bin 是否啟用了日誌 mysql show variables like log 怎樣知道當前的日誌 mysql show ma...

MYSQL啟用日誌,和檢視日誌

mysql有以下幾種日誌 錯誤日誌 log err 查詢日誌 log 慢查詢日誌 log slow queries 更新日誌 log update 二進位制日誌 log bin 是否啟用了日誌 mysql show variables like log 怎樣知道當前的日誌 mysql show ma...

MYSQL啟用日誌,和檢視日誌

mysql有以下幾種日誌 錯誤日誌 log err 查詢日誌 log 慢查詢日誌 log slow queries 更新日誌 log update 二進位制日誌 log bin 是否啟用了日誌 mysql show variables like log 怎樣知道當前的日誌 mysql show ma...